The meeting on Sunday, JVIay 16, will be called "Clerks' Sunday," being in charge of different clerks of the city. On the 25th of this month a banqnet will be giveu to the members of tha different corurnittees. This banquet will be in charge of the entertainment aud reception committees. At a meeting of the JBicycle Club last Tuenday night, Ed. Krapf was elected president, Ed. Chapin vicepresident, and A. Walker secretary and treasurer. Some interestiug eventa will soou be given by this club. The tutal attendanoe at the ■ gospel meetings for the month of April was 412, an average of 103. The attendance at the prayer meetings was 112, an average of 23. These meetings are growing in spirit as well as in nnmbers. The men's meeting at the ï. M. C. A. rooms next Suuday will be in charge of Prof. E. Meusel. His snbject will be "Thf Cbristiau Bace." The solo that was to be Kiven Iaat Suuday by Miss Vjhaud will be suug at this meoting.
